Yoshii Station (吉井駅, Yoshii-eki) is a railway station in Tomioka, Gunma, Japan, operated by the private railway operator Jōshin Dentetsu.

Lines

Yoshii Station is a station on the Jōshin Line and is 11.7 kilometers from the terminus of the line at Takasaki.

Station layout

The station has a single island platform connected to the station building by a level crossing.

History

Yoshii Station opened on 5 May 1897.
